    Please update the AMD Raid Controller drivers from HP.

    Code:
    2: kd> lmvm ahcix64s
    Browse full module list
    start             end                 module name
    fffff880`01b48000 fffff880`01b98000   ahcix64s T (no symbols)           
        Loaded symbol image file: ahcix64s.sys
        Image path: \SystemRoot\system32\DRIVERS\ahcix64s.sys
        Image name: ahcix64s.sys
        Browse all global symbols  functions  data
        Timestamp:        Tue Mar 17 07:38:19 2009 (49BF455B)
        CheckSum:         00038ADE
        ImageSize:        00050000
        Translations:     0000.04b0 0000.04e4 0409.04b0 0409.04e4
